Introduction: Bragg's law


Bragg's law states that the difference in path length between beams scattered of two adjacent lattice planes of a crystal has to be a multiple of the wavelength, . Mathematically, this is written as:

nlambda = 2 d sin(theta)

where n is an integer number, d is the distance between two crystal planes and 2theta is the scattering angle, i.e. the angle between the incoming and outgoing beams.
